Oven Mitt Pattern & Tutorial

Oven Mitt Pattern & Tutorial
This image courtesy of marymarthamama.com

From the Blogger: "Oven mitts make a great gift for a housewarming or wedding shower. Give a couple of these in a fabric that matches the recipient's style along with some baking pans and you've got a great gift. You can quickly and easily sew one up using this free printable pattern and tutorial. Even beginning sewists can complete this project. It does not require much fabric either, so it is a great one for using up some of your larger scrap pieces leftover from other projects."

Project TypeMake a Project

Time to CompleteUnder an hour

Sewn byMachine

Beginner

Materials List

  • Woven cotton fabric for the outside of the mitt and the lining
  • Insulated batting

I like this simple straightforward oven mitt pattern. I would add a small loop of material or fold over binding in a coordinating color for easy hanging on a kitchen hook. If the Insul-Brite batting is not available, then a few layers of cotton (not polyester) batting would work as well.
